How much do remote controller j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 7,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ote controller in Exton, PA is $115,332.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$93,600.00 and $133,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ote controller?

A Remote Controller is a financial professional responsible for overseeing accounting operations, financial reporting, and budgeting for a company, all while working remotely. They ensure compliance with regulations, manage financial records, and provide strategic insights to leadership. This role often involves supervising accounting teams, preparing financial statements, and optimizing financial processes. Remote Controllers use cloud-based accounting software and digital collaboration tools to perform their duties ef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ote controller?

Succeeding as a Remote Controller requires strong financial acumen, attention to detail, and typically a bachelor's degree in accounting, finance, or a related field. Familiarity with ERP systems such as SAP or Oracle, advanced Excel skills, and accounting certifications like CPA or CMA are highly valuable. Excellent communication, time management, and problem-solving skills help Remote Controllers coordinate with dispersed teams and handle complex financial scenarios. These abilities ensure accurate financial oversight, timely reporting, and effective teamwork in a remote work environment.

What are some common challenges faced by remote controllers and how can they be overcome?

Remote Controllers often face challenges such as maintaining accurate financial controls across multiple locations, collaborating with virtual teams, and ensuring timely communication with stakeholders. To overcome these challenges, they leverage digital tools for real-time reporting, establish clear processes for document management, and prioritize regular virtual meetings for team alignment. Developing strong organizational habits and proactive communication skills can also help ensure compliance and accuracy. By adapting to these challenges, Remote Controllers can support their organizations effectively while working remotely.

Job description

Regional Sales Manager 

Job Description: 
We are a leading global manufacturer of signaling devices and visual/audible notification products, including network-controlled signal towers, beacon lights, MP3 audible alarms, and LED work/task lighting. Our products are used across a wide range of industries, including industrial manufacturing, factory automation, commercial, healthcare, security, and food & beverage applications. We are seeking an experienced and motivated Regional Sales Manager to lead and grow sales efforts within the automation and industrial sector. This role is responsible for executing strategic sales initiatives, managing key customer relationships, and driving revenue growth throughout the assigned territory. 

The ideal candidate will work closely with existing Channel Partners to proactively drive product sales, strengthen partner relationships, and provide technical and commercial support. 

Responsibilities include identifying growth opportunities, training distributor sales teams, expanding end-user accounts, and coordinating with internal teams to deliver effective customer solutions. This position will also focus on developing new OEM business by identifying target accounts, building relationships with decision-makers, and securing opportunities for automation solutions. The successful candidate should be comfortable managing longer sales cycles, uncovering application needs, presenting value-based proposals, and converting prospects into long-term customers. 

As the Regional Sales Manager, the selected candidate will be based in or near the assigned territory to support efficient travel and customer coverage. Responsibilities include prospecting new customers, actively following up on leads, supporting current customers and channel partners, and regularly visiting potential customers alongside distribution partners. Travel is expected to be up to 50% within the assigned region. 

Key Responsibilities: 
• Develop and execute a regional sales strategy aligned with company goals and KPIs. 
• Identify, target, and close new business opportunities within the automation and industrial markets. 
• Manage and grow relationships with OEMs, system integrators, distributors, and end users. 
• Provide technical and commercial support throughout the sales cycle. 
• Conduct product presentations, demonstrations, and solution-based discussions tailored to customer needs. 
• Monitor market trends, competitor activity, and customer feedback to support business strategy. 
• Prepare sales forecasts, activity reports, and territory growth plans. 
• Represent the company at industry trade shows, events, and customer meetings. 
• Support and develop channel partner relationships to increase market share and revenue growth. 
• Collaborate with internal teams including customer service, engineering, and marketing to ensure customer success. 

Education/Experience: 
•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Business, or a related field preferred (Electrical, Mechanical, or Industrial Engineering strongly preferred). 
• Minimum 3+ years of hands-on B2B sales experience in automation, industrial controls, or related technical industries. 
• Experience working with distributors, OEM accounts, and channel sales models. 
• Proven success in territory growth, channel sales, and account management 
• Experience using CRM platforms such as Salesforce or HubSpot. 

Required Skills: 
• Strong technical knowledge of automation systems such as PLCs, HMIs, VFDs, SCADA, robotics, sensors, and industrial communication protocols such as EtherNet/IP, Modbus, and PROFINET. 
• Experience selling into manufacturing, automotive, food & beverage, packaging, material handling, logistics, or oil & gas industries. 
• Strong communication, presentation, negotiation, and relationship-building skills 
• Self-motivated with the ability to work independently and manage a regional territory effectively 
• Willingness to travel up to 50%.
